Pals Electric, C-10 Electrical Contractor in Tustin, CA
Pals Electric operating as a limited liability hol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1140995), valid through Jul 31, 2027. First issued in 2025,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 1 year.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-10 — Electrical Contractor. Records show a previously-filed surety bond from Western Surety Company that is no longer active and an exempt workers' compensation status (no employees on payroll). The business is based in Tustin, in Orange County, California.
